Transaction 66a5a3b12730a628407d41fea1a32c0568e8d7a3a0cc2907fdf9fc723285be48
1 Input
1 Output
-
66a5a3b12730a628407d41fea1a32c0568e8d7a3a0cc2907fdf9fc723285be48:0
- value
- 63533
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 372107b476fb728e444e2e3ada781e2d55e2a6d0 OP_EQUAL
- address
- 36iWf4mhmrfwU216wUWoPbgsamy8VLQSvf